Position: HR Coordinator (contract)

Overview

NearU is a people-centric, process-driven, and technology-enabled customer service platform dedicated to revolutionizing the home services industry by vastly improving the customer and employee experience.

Responsibilities
  • Coordinate pre-employment activities such as background checks, drug screening, MVR, etc.
  • Initiate candidates' electronic onboarding process and maintain communication with incoming employees.
  • Initiate new hires training including safety and compliance training.
  • Complete the HR new hire electronic forms – E-Verify, policy acknowledgement forms, etc.
  • Support HR in maintaining legal compliance – managing expired documents, filing documents, etc.
  • Assist with the processing or auditing of terminations.
  • Maintain compliance with federal, state, and local employment laws and regulations, and recommended best practices; review policies and practices to maintain compliance.
  • Assist in the coordination and/or communication of HR activities or programs.
  • Maintain trackers for a variety of onboarding activities.
  • Support recruitment team to source candidates on Indeed proactively.
